went watched KJ play today against Hays. He was predictably dominant. Hays didn't really offer anything in the way of slowing Westlake down. KJ probably shit something like 9/11 from the field and was 3/3 or 4/4 from the line. He also probably had 7-8 assists, five of them in the first half. KJ essentially sat out the 4Q as Westlake was running away with it. 

As for the Chaps, Coach Lucero has a really good team. They lost some talented players from last year, and physically they are far from imposing (it's KJ and a bunch of small guys who weigh 140 lbs), but they spread the floor very well, they move the ball well, they shot the ball well, and they hustle. Pretty impressive for them to be 20-1 on the season.
